    I had a 5300ES then Sony replaced it with a 5700ES for free. both were very nice AVR's great on music. One thing Sony didn't do well on was movies. My Marantz is by far better than either of the two on movies and can hold it's own on music.

    I have that receiver 11 years old solid as a rock. When I went to LSI 15.s and an Lsic center, monitor 70,s side suuround,s. I added an Emotiva XPA5 gen 1. It as well is solid runs cool. The only thing my ES5300 powers are two FXI 3,s for my rear surrounds.
